ну, для чего от неё избавляться?
она не избыточна: новый функционал будет все равно вязаться на эту зависимость
зависимость не является частной реализации, и даже напротив, небольшим стандартом
зависимость так и так будет в проекте, но не через нашу либу: сейчас сложно представить пакеты с php, которые работают с web и не имеют под боком psr интерфейса
более того,
@roxblnfk помню делал большой пакет с заголовками (кстати, как он там?). для него точно понадобится интерфейсы реквеста/респонса